#bb021c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b021c is composed of 73.3% red, 0.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 85%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 37.1%. #bb021c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0438 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#bb021c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b021c has RGB values of R:187, G:2,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.85,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12255772.

Hex triplet bb021c #bb021c
RGB Decimal 187, 2, 28 rgb(187,2,28)
RGB Percent 73.3, 0.8, 11 rgb(73.3%,0.8%,11%)
CMYK 0, 99, 85, 27
HSL 351.6°, 97.9, 37.1 hsl(351.6,97.9%,37.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 351.6°, 98.9, 73.3
Web Safe cc0033 #cc0033
CIE-LAB 39.062, 63.616, 41.542
XYZ 20.726, 10.695, 2.072
xyY 0.619, 0.319, 10.695
CIE-LCH 39.062, 75.978, 33.145
CIE-LUV 39.062, 124.227, 23.049
Hunter-Lab 32.703, 55.897, 19.136
Binary 10111011, 00000010, 00011100

Shades and Tints of #bb021c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0002 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.
